Output 5786bda379e08681c53e7579a965bc0f824fcec3976b59bb0abfc2a53e4ea4ba:3

value
25928863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c426d4c4c553dfdb59db5c6a23b28d34090054b OP_EQUAL
address
MErPAS9XMRtfSRZyiDQm9xjuQbH88tY26c
transaction
5786bda379e08681c53e7579a965bc0f824fcec3976b59bb0abfc2a53e4ea4ba
spent
true